AI Is Ruthless Because It's Emotionless

The use of AI and agents in decision-making processes eliminates the need for human judgment. The specific choices, such as database selection or cloud platform, no longer matter because an agent can find the most cost-effective solution. AI is emotionless and executes tasks without bias or personal preferences. These agents operate within set budgets and can optimize resource allocation accordingly. This shift towards AI-driven decision-making threatens established organizations with complex go-to-market strategies, as it renders them obsolete. The rise of AI-powered agents also paves the way for the emergence of one-person teams that can build entire technology stacks using these agents. This revolutionary change in decision-making provides opportunities for shorting established companies and empowering the new generation of rebels.
